Recent clinical trials are starting to fill the knowledge gap around cannabinoid-based treatments in veterinary medicine. As our understanding of the endocannabinoid system grows, so does the recognition of the therapeutic potential for chronic conditions like osteoarthritis, epilepsy, and behavioral disorders.
